When you become a puppy raiser, you'll meet a puppy who'll become part of your life for 12 to 15 months. Through daily care and training, you'll build the foundation for your puppy to become a trusted guide dog for someone who is blind!
Puppy raising is the adventure of a lifetime, and every adventure comes with challenges and rewards. We’re here to help.
You don't need any previous experience raising a puppy to become a puppy raiser. We'll help you every step of the way. The Leader Dog puppy raising community is also a great source of support—no matter what your situation is, your fellow raisers are ready to share stories, suggestions and the latest photos of their growing puppies.
